At the age of 70, Antonis Karras, a former member of the Democratic Alarm, Famagusta, passed away suddenly at noon at 2006.

Antonis Karras, was born in 1947 in Paralimni and after his tenure in the National Guard, he studied at the Law School of the National Kapodistrian University of Athens and Political Science at the Panteion University of Athens.

He was a distinguished lawyer, a profession he practiced until today. During the Turkish invasion, he served as a reserve officer in the 336th Recruitment Battalion under Major Dimitris Alevromagiros, with a significant contribution to the battles for the defense of Nicosia against the advance of the Turkish invading forces. For his action he was nominated for the Medal of Excellence.

He was a founding member of DISY and also served as deputy mayor of Famagusta. He entered Parliament in 1993 as the first runner-up after the victory of Glafkos Clerides in the presidential elections and the appointment of Claire Angelidou as minister.

He developed a rich parliamentary activity and was the chairman of parliamentary committees. He was re-elected as a Member of Parliament in the 1996 and 2001 elections. In 2004-2006 he was the party's parliamentary representative.

He leaves behind a wife, a daughter and a son.

The announcement of the Police

According to the Police, yesterday at noon while the former DISY MP Antonis Karas, 70 years old, was in the yard of his residence in Paralimni, for a reason unknown until now, he lost consciousness.

An ambulance from a private clinic transported him to the Famagusta General Hospital, where the doctor on duty confirmed his death.

Members of the Paralimni Police Station inspected the body without detecting any external injuries and criminal activity was ruled out.

The exact causes of death of Antonis Karas will be ascertained during the legal autopsy that will be performed this morning on his body at the Larnaca General Hospital by the medical examiner Sophocles Sophocles.
